Description
This work delves into the fascinating relationship between modern sculpture and architecture, exploring how these two art forms interact and influence each other. With contributions from prominent figures in the field, it highlights the phenomena where structures and sculptures converge, blurring the lines between built environments and artistic expression. Through a series of insightful essays and analyses, readers are invited to consider the spatial and aesthetic dialogues that emerge when sculpture is integrated into architectural settings.
The authors provide a comprehensive look at various case studies, emphasizing the transformational potential of combining these disciplines. Each chapter presents unique perspectives, showcasing how modern sculptural practices contribute to spatial experiences and the visual narratives of urban landscapes. This exploration ultimately encourages a reevaluation of the spaces around us, prompting a deeper appreciation for the synergy between materiality and artistic intent.
